Systray should be in c:\windows\system (or applicable drive letter), but I don't see how that would help.

I believe the likely cause is the amount of RAM you're using. Windows 98 has problems running on a system with over 512 MB RAM. I had a similar experience with my sound card (game theatre XP) driver with just 512 MB RAM, especially when running other programs at startup. There may be a workaround--see this MS KB article--http://support.microsoft.com/default...n_SRCH&SPR=W98--but I don't know if that will solve all your problems. My advice would be to upgrade to windows 2000 or XP. If that's possible it would probably be the easiest solution.

Oh, yes, and if you do upgrade to windows XP/2000, I'd recommend dual booting--install XP/2000 to a new partition and keep windows 98 for compatibility with some programs.
